Description of Services:
Keystone Child, Youth
& Family Services is a free, voluntary, not-for-profit organization and the
designated Children's mental Health Lead Agency for Grey and Bruce Counties.
Counselling Programs - Individual, family and group counselling for ages 0 – 17 * including risk assessments, urgent and crisis support
Youth Live-In Treatment Program - 7 bed co-ed crisis, assessment and stabilization program for youth aged 12 to 17
ONWorkshops and Support Groups - Workshops and groups that support children, youth and families with mental health, parenting and prevention
Special Needs Programming - Supports children and families with complex special needs
Youth Justice Support - Youth justice support, diversion and assessment
Prevention and Community Support Programs - Programs for children aged 0-6, and new and expectant parents.Programs include:
